Audi S8 (2011) Confirmed – Audi S7 and Audi S1 planned
Tue, 01 Dec 2009Audi has confirmed the 2011 S8 and an S1 and S7 The ink has just dried on our report on the new 2011 Audi A8 (well, you know what I mean) when we got news that Audi are going to produce an Audi S8 , despite earlier reports that there would be no S8 for the 2011 model, or even the W12 A8. But it doesn’t stop there. In an unguarded moment Audi’s Design Director Stefan Sielaff said that the ‘Design Grammar’ of the A8 would extend in to the S8, the S7 and the S1.
CDN/GM-PATAC competition deadline extended
Fri, 08 Feb 2013We're now three months into the CDN-GM/PATAC Interactive Design Competition China, and here at CDN we're excited to see some many strong entries coming in. Because there has been such a flurry of quality entries leading up to the first round deadline, we're happy to announce that the deadlines have been adjusted to allow for more students to compete for two internships with GM in China. All entries must now be received by March 1, 2013 in order to qualify for judging.
India Vehicle Design Summit 2014 announced for April
Mon, 27 Jan 2014The India Vehicle Design Summit 2014 will be the first in its history to focus exclusively on the ‘design and styling' of commercial and passenger vehicles. Taking place at The Corinthians Resort and Club in Pune from 24-25 April, the summit will feature speakers from brands including Jaguar, Ferrari and McLaren and industry experts from companies such as Volvo, GM and Tata as well as institutions such as the National Institute of Design in India and London's Royal College of Arts. Confirmed speakers include Volvo China's chief designer Gustavo Guerra, renowned designer Peter Stevens and Anil Saiini, director of design at GM India.
